News Summary

Neutral

STM demonstrated strong sequential recovery through Q1 2026 with 23% YoY revenue growth and improving margins, supported by normalized inventory and resilient data center demand; Q2 2026 guidance projects continued momentum with 24.9% YoY growth and 34.8% gross margin. However, significant structural headwinds persist: unused capacity charges continue to pressure margins, the company faces a major 3-year restructuring with up to 2,800 voluntary departures, and prior quarterly guidance misses (particularly Q3 2025 revenue outlook shock causing 17% intraday decline) signal execution risk.

Red flags

  • Q3 2025 revenue guidance missed expectations, causing 17% intraday stock decline—largest since July 2025
  • Unused capacity charges expected to continue impacting gross margins in upcoming quarters
  • Major manufacturing overhaul underway with up to 2,800 voluntary departures over 3 years, execution risk on promised cost savings
  • Q4 2025 net loss of $30M vs. $341M prior year profit, driven partly by noncash tax charges but signaling volatility
  • Gross margin trajectory uncertain despite recent 33.8% Q1 result; guidance range of ±200 bps indicates significant variability
